Hymn: Be joyful in God all ye lands of the earth (FL)

Hymnal: Christian Psalms and Hymns

Date: 1839

Compiler: Walter Scott and Silas Leonard

Publisher/Printer: A S Tilden

First Line: Be joyful in God all ye lands of the earth

Lyics

BE joyful in God, all ye lands of the earth,

O serve him with gladness and fear;

Exult in his presence with music and mirth,

With love and devotion draw near,



The Lord he is God, and Jehovah alone,

Creator and ruler o'er all;

And we are his people, his sceptre we own:

His sheep, and we follow his call,



O enter his gates with thanksgiving and song,

Your vows in his temple proclaim;

His praise with melodious concordance prolong,

And bless his adorable name,



For good is the Lord, inexpressibly good,

And we are the work of his hand:

His mercy and truth from eternity stood,

And shall to eternity stand.
